Good Morning Britain host Richard Madeley was forced to intervene when a debate on the show became 'lively'.
The presenter and co-host Susanna Reid were joined on Wednesday's show by Kerry Katona and Tessa Hartman to debate bikini's for children.
It comes after high-street retailer New Look were heavily criticised last week for one of its kids' bikinis.

Kerry Katona fled the I'm A Celebrity castle in Wales after a chilling encounter with the paranormal while on a ghost hunt.The mum-of-five, who had an explosive showdown on Good Morning Britain, was joined by her lookalike daughter Lilly-Sue, 18, for an evening of ghosts and ghouls on Wednesday. Despite initially being up for the challenge, the 40 year old left the tour before it was over, leaving her daughter to carry on without her.

Project Reveal - Ghosts of Britain were joined at Gwrych Castle in Abergele by former I'm A Celeb winner Kerry Katona, her daughter Lilly-Sue McFadden and TV spiritualist James Higgins. The event was broadcast live on Facebook, where Kerry could be heard leaving the investigation during a ritual in a quick exit while more than 4,000 people tuned in.
